WebDogs may also be offered a small amount of cooked vegetables such as pumpkin or carrots. A small amount of plain cooked pasta or rice may also be offered. Cooked meat, such as boiled chicken or lamb, may also be offered, but ensure there are no cooked bones and no onions/onion sauces or other toxic substances present (see below). WebNov 26, 2024 · Yes, dogs can eat chicken backs and this part of the chicken is made up of approximately 20% meat which will provide protein and a little fat, and 80% bone, tender and easy to chew which will provide Calcium. This part of the chicken is a source of glucosamine, iron, niacin, essential fatty acids, and vitamins A, and B.
